Lebanon: UNIFIL Headquarters bombed. 4 soldiers endured minor injuries

Four Italian soldiers endured minor injuries as two 122mm rockets hit Shama UNP 2-3 Base in Southern Lebanon, headquarters to the Italian contingent and UNIFIL Sector West Command.

“I have immediately got in contact with the Contingent Commander, Brigadier General Stefano Messina, to ascertain that the conditions of the four soldiers were not concerning. I have also spoken with my Lebanese counterpart, reiterating that the UNIFIL Italian contingent is still in Southern Lebanon to offer peace a window of opportunity, and that it cannot be the target of militia attacks. It is not tolerable that a UNIFIL Base was hit again. I will try to talk to the new Israeli Defence Minister, which has proved impossible since his appointment, to ask him to prevent UNIFIL bases from being used as shields. The presence of terrorists who jeopardize the security of the Blue Helmets and civilian population in Southern Lebanon is even more intolerable”, Minister Crosetto said.

An initial investigation established that two rockets hit a bunker and a facility near the International Military Police station at the base, damaging the surrounding infrastructures. The four soldiers were wounded by glass shards caused by the explosion.
